Steering device for motor vehicle

There is disclosed a steering apparatus for a vehicle in which a steering power of a steering shaft is assisted by a column-assist type electric power steering apparatus so that the steering power is transmitted to steer the wheels by means of a steering mechanism, in which a telescopic shaft with a male shaft and a female shaft fitted to each other to be mutually unrotatable and slidable is interposed between an output shaft of said column-assist type electric power steering apparatus and an input shaft of the steering mechanism.

Styrene-based polymer, styrene-based copolymer, rubber composition and pneumatic tire

This invention relates to a styrene-based (co)polymer capable of improving tan δ of a rubber composition while ensuring a fracture resistance of the rubber composition by adding to the rubber composition, and more particularly to a styrene-based polymer obtained by homopolymerizing a styrene derivative and having a weight average molecular weight as converted to polystyrene of 2×103 to 50×103, and a styrene-based copolymer obtained by copolymerizing styrene and at least one of styrene derivatives and having a weight average molecular weight as converted to polystyrene of 2×103 to 50×103.

Cloth boundary recognition method for sewing machine and sensor and identification device thereof

The invention relates to a cloth boundary recognition method for a sewing machine and a sensor and an identification device thereof, and belongs to the technical field of intelligent automatic sewingrobot control. A red light LDE light source is converted into a linear light source through a multiple layers of lens, the linear light source is reflected by a reflector to a lens group to be concentrated to form a point-distance linear beam, the point-distance linear beam is irradiated on a linear CCD sensor to form analog voltage output of a dot array, and the cloth boundary recognition sensoris constituted. The analog voltage of the dot array outputted by the cloth boundary recognition sensor is directly sent to an AD port of a MCU for calculation processing, and a digital quantity is transmitted outward through a communication circuit to constitute the cloth boundary identification device of the sewing machine. The cloth boundary recognition sensor adopts a linear CCD photosensitivechip, and the recognition precision is greatly improved; the MCU directly receives an analog voltage value, and the digital quantity is transmitted outward through the communication circuit after thecalculation processing, thereby avoiding interference on an analog signal transmitting over a long distance, and improving the stability of the cloth boundary identification sensor.

Navigation radar antenna multi-angle rotating support

The invention relates to the technical field of navigation, and discloses a navigation radar antenna multi-angle rotating support comprising an antenna. The left side of the antenna is fixedly connected with an inclined support, and the left side of the antenna is fixedly connected with a fixed support. According to the multi-angle rotating support for the navigation radar antenna, a first motor is started to enable a first gear to drive a second gear to rotate, and the second gear is in threaded connection with a telescopic rod, so that the telescopic rod can move up and down to further enable the antenna to move up and down, and the effect of quickly and stably adjusting the height of the antenna is achieved; a third motor is started to enable a fourth gear to drive a third gear to rotate, at the moment, the third gear can drive a threaded rod to rotate, and the threaded rod moves left and right; the inclination angle of the antenna is further changed; a second motor is started to enable the antenna to rapidly and stably rotate, and therefore the effect that the radar antenna is more stable, faster and more convenient to steer is achieved.
